What Arizona Employers Look For

The qualifications that appear most often in sales account manager jobs across Arizona.

  • Bachelor's degree in business, marketing, communications, or a related field preferred
  • Two or more years of B2B or direct sales experience with measurable quota attainment
  • Proven ability to manage a full sales cycle from prospecting through contract close
  • Proficiency with CRM platforms such as Salesforce or HubSpot for pipeline management
  • Strong communication and presentation skills for client-facing and executive-level meetings
  • Experience selling within Arizona's technology, healthcare, or financial services markets

Sales Account Manager Jobs in Arizona: Frequently Asked Questions

How do you become a sales account manager in Arizona?

Most Arizona employers expect a bachelor's degree in business, marketing, or a related field alongside prior sales or customer-facing experience, though no state-issued license is required for the role. Many candidates start in inside sales, business development representative, or account coordinator positions at Arizona-based companies before moving into account management. Earning a Salesforce certification or completing a structured sales training program strengthens your candidacy considerably with Arizona's technology and healthcare employers.

How much do sales account managers make in Arizona?

Sales account managers in Arizona earn a median of about $145,690 a year, based on May 2025 Bureau of Labor Statistics wage data, ranging from around $74,510 for the lowest 10% to over $255,220 for the top 10%. Pay rises with experience, specialty, and employer.

Are there remote sales account manager jobs in Arizona?

Yes, and more than most fields. Sales account management is heavily relationship-driven but largely desk-based for inside and enterprise roles, which makes remote and hybrid arrangements common. About 64% of sales account manager openings tied to Arizona are remote or hybrid as of September 2026, reflecting how widely distributed client bases have become. Enterprise software and SaaS account management roles tend to offer the most remote flexibility, while territory-based or field sales positions typically require in-person coverage.

How can I get hired as a sales account manager in Arizona with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ry path is landing a business development representative or inside sales associate role at one of Arizona's technology or healthcare companies, then moving into account management after demonstrating quota attainment. Large Phoenix-area employers including Banner Health, Axon, and Insight Direct regularly hire for structured sales development programs that build toward account management. Completing a Salesforce certification and building a record of outbound prospecting results gives candidates with limited experience a concrete edge in Arizona applications.
